Barry R. Port
2012
In 2012, Barry R. Port earned a total compensation of $1.3M as Chief Operating Officer, Ensign Services, Inc at Ensign Group.
Compensation breakdown
Non-Equity Incentive Plan | $726,464 |
---|---|
Option Awards | $98,340 |
Salary | $300,000 |
Stock Awards | $189,086 |
Other | $12,413 |
Total | $1,326,303 |
Port received $726.5K in non-equity incentive plan, accounting for 55% of the total pay in 2012.
Port also received $98.3K in option awards, $300K in salary, $189.1K in stock awards and $12.4K in other compensation.
